Taiwanese couple Chang Meng-Chung and Hung Wen-ting, linked to a pro-China political party, have been charged by Taiwanese prosecutors for promoting Chinese political agendas and violating election laws. They allegedly received 2.32 million dollars from Chinese authorities over a decade and produced radio and digital media propaganda for China. The couple could face up to 5 years in prison and a fine of NT$10 million.
